Rift Valley fever virus (RVFV) is a mosquito-transmitted virus from the Bunyaviridae family that causes high rates of mortality and morbidity in humans and ruminant animals. Previous studies indicated that DEAD-box helicase 17 (DDX17) restricts RVFV replication by recognizing two primary non-coding RNAs in the S-segment of the genome: the intergenic region (IGR) and 5′ non-coding region (NCR). However, we lack molecular insights into the direct binding of DDX17 with RVFV non-coding RNAs and information on the unwinding of both non-coding RNAs by DDX17. Therefore, we performed an extensive biophysical analysis of the DDX17 helicase domain (DDX17135–555) and RVFV non-coding RNAs, IGR and 5’ NCR. The homogeneity studies using analytical ultracentrifugation indicated that DDX17135–555, IGR, and 5’ NCR are pure. Next, we performed small-angle X-ray scattering (SAXS) experiments, which suggested that DDX17 and both RNAs are homogenous as well. SAXS analysis also demonstrated that DDX17 is globular to an extent, whereas the RNAs adopt an extended conformation in solution. Subsequently, microscale thermophoresis (MST) experiments were performed to investigate the direct binding of DDX17 to the non-coding RNAs. The MST experiments demonstrated that DDX17 binds with the IGR and 5’ NCR with a dissociation constant of 5.77 ± 0.15 µM and 9.85 ± 0.11 µM, respectively. As DDX17135–555 is an RNA helicase, we next determined if it could unwind IGR and NCR. We developed a helicase assay using MST and fluorescently-labeled oligos, which suggested DDX17135–555 can unwind both RNAs. Overall, our study provides direct evidence of DDX17135–555 interacting with and unwinding RVFV non-coding regions.  相似文献

Zusammenfassung Es wird ein neuentwickelter Hochleistungsmeßoszillograph mit abgeschmolzener Braunscher Röhre beschrieben, der in seiner Meßleistung die bisherigen, an der Pumpe betriebenen Kathodenstrahloszillographen erreicht, im Gegensatz zu diesen aber als tragbares Gerät ausgebildet ist. Der Oszillograph arbeitet mit Außenaufnahme mittels Kamera und Linse. Weiterhin wird über einen ebenfalls neuentwickelten Demonstrations-Kathodenstrahloszillographen berichtet, der dazu bestimmt ist, auch in den größten Hörsälen elektrische Vorgänge bis zu Tonfrequenzen hinauf als einmalige Vorgänge zu projizieren.An der Entwicklung der Braunschen Röhrc haben die Herren Dr. H. Rab proteins are geranylgeranylated on one or two C-terminal cysteines by Rab geranylgeranyl transferase (RabGGTase). The reaction is dependent on a Rab-binding protein, termed Rab escort protein (REP). Here, we studied the role of REP in the geranylgeranylation reaction. We first characterized the interaction between REP and ungeranylgeranylated Rab using analytical ultracentrifugation and a fluorescence-based assay. We measured an equilibrium dissociation constant of 0.2 microM for the formation of a 1:1 REP-Rab complex and showed that this interaction relies mostly on ionic bonds and does not involve the two C-terminal cysteine residues. Second, we show that REP is required for recognition of Rab by RabGGTase and therefore that the REP-Rab complex is the true substrate for RabGGTase. Third, we show that free REP inhibits the geranylgeranylation reaction, suggesting that the complex is recognized by RabGGTase primarily via a REP-binding site. Our data suggest a model whereby REP behaves kinetically as an essential activator of the reaction.  相似文献

The pyruvate dehydrogenase complex is a large, highly organized assembly of several different catalytic and regulatory component enzymes. The structural core of the complex is the E2-X subcomplex, consisting of 60 dihydrolipoamide transacetylase (E2) subunits arranged in a pentagonal dodecahedron; 6 protein X and 2 pyruvate dehydrogenase kinase molecules are tightly associated with this E2 60-mer. The native E2-X subcomplex exhibits a sedimentation coefficient of 32 S. The effects of several chaotropes (guanidinium chloride, potassium thiocyanide, and urea) on the E2-X subcomplex were assessed. Treatment of the E2-X subcomplex with 4 M guanidinium chloride caused a complete loss of enzymatic activity and the dissociation of the subcomplex into monomeric 1.5-3 S species. Removal of the chaotrope by dialysis for 18 h resulted in complete restoration of E2 enzymatic activity and reassembly of a 32 S subcomplex; this reassembled subcomplex contained less protein X than the native subcomplex. Sedimentation velocity analysis of reassembled E2-X subcomplex demonstrated the presence of an 8 S assembly intermediate; this sedimentation coefficient is characteristic of globular proteins of molecular weights similar to that expected for a trimer of E2. Shorter periods of dialysis also gave rise to the 8 S species; the amount of this intermediate decreased with increasing times of dialysis. The 8 S species associated non-cooperatively to yield additional assembly intermediates exhibiting sedimentation coefficients of 10-32 S.  相似文献

Zusammenfassung Die durch die eigene Raumladung verursachte Durchmesserzunahme eines Elektronenstrahles wird unter der Voraussetzung unveränderlicher Stromdichte über den jeweiligen Strahlquerschnitt und einheitlicher Elektronengeschwindigkeit berechnet. Im Gegensatz zu früheren Veröffentlichungen, in denen nur die Durchmesserzunahme des anfangs parallelen Strahles angegeben wurde, wird für den meist vorliegenden Fall bestimmter (positiver oder negativer) Apertur des Strahles die zahlenmäßige Berechnung der gesamten Durchmesserveränderung, also der geometrischen Durchmesserzunahme oder -abnähmezusammen mit der durch Raumladung verursachten Durchmesserzunahme, auf die Benutzung einer Kurventafel mit Hilfe zweier GrößenA undB zurückgeführt, die aus den gegebenen Werten (Strahlspannung und -strom, Strahllänge, Anfangshalbmesser und -richtung) berechnet oder aus Nomogrammen abgelesen werden können. Die Kurvendarstellungen werden durch Angabe von Näherungsformeln und deren Gültigkeitsbereichen ergänzt. An Hand einiger Beispiele und weiterer Anwendungen wird die Benutzung der Ergebnisse und der Tafeln erläutert.  相似文献

Under the auspices of the Inter-American Metrology System (SIM), the National Institute of Standards and Technology (NIST) initiated a regional comparison for type K thermocouples from (100 to 1,100) °C with 11 participating countries. The use of type K material above approximately 200 °C is considered destructive. Therefore, each participating laboratory was sent new, unused wire from a lot of material characterized by NIST. The uniformity of the lot was remarkable, especially at temperatures above 500 °C; the standard deviation of the thermocouple emf values of multiple cuts tested at NIST was 2.7 μV or less over the full temperature range. The high uniformity eliminated any need to correct for variations of the transfer standard among the laboratories, greatly simplifying the analysis. The level of agreement among the laboratories’ results was quite good. Even though test procedures and equipment varied significantly among the participants, the standard deviation of all emf values at each test temperature was less than the equivalent of 0.20 °C at 200 °C and below, and less than 0.60 °C from (400 to 1,100) °C. Of the 380 total bilateral combinations of the data at the eight test temperatures, only 13 (i.e., 3.4% of all combinations) are outside the k = 2 limits, and of these 13, only 3 are outside k = 3 limits. All the outliers occur at temperatures of 800 °C and below, which suggests that drift of the type K wire due to high-temperature oxidation did not cause changes in the thermocouple emf comparable to or larger than the claimed uncertainties.  相似文献
